"Spin Spin Sugar" is a single released by Sneaker Pimps from their debut album Becoming X.

The album version is in true Sneaker Pimps style and format. There is a driving bass line produced by a synthesizer keyboard. As the bass drives, there is a second synth loop playing above.

The song was featured in The Girl Next Door soundtrack in its radio edit form. A music video was made for the radio edit version and features the bandmates in what appears to be a highly colorized motel room, with many references to the film Psycho.

"Spin Spin Sugar" was further popularized in a speed garage remix by Armand Van Helden, which is sometimes credited with breaking speed garage into the mainstream for the first time. The remix appears in Dance Dance Revolution Extreme 2 and Grand Theft Auto: Liberty City Stories. Redbull.com included the remix in their "Honorable mentions" list of "underground UK garage classics that still sound fresh today".[1]

Chart positions

Chart (1997) Position
Australian ARIA Singles Chart[4] 126
UK Singles Chart 21
UK Dance Chart[5] 1
U.S. Billboard Hot 100 87
U.S. Billboard Hot Dance Club Songs[6] 2
Chart (2015) Peak
position
U.S. Billboard Dance Club Songs[7] 7

Cover versions

  • In 2015, Scotty Boy featuring Sue Cho recorded a version which made the US Dance Club Songs chart.
